                          Well that's fine if it does help. But, it does NOT remove the smell. You are still breathing it in, which can be dangerous.

                          An N95 is STRICTLY a particulate mask (I know, as my fiance is an RN)

                          A P100 would be the safest for removing paint fumes and the like. (I know as I wear one of these at work regularly)

                          Using an N95 for incorrect purposes can be dangerous. Even deadly. The thing is, the smell of the mask hides the smell. (like putting your sleeve over your nose. But those vapours are still getting through!)...

                          I hope this doesn't come off as being rude... I am just stating this for everones safety and well being.

                          I don't know how many times I've witnessed someone using toxic solvent based products while wearing a drywall mask.
